How they compare

Kiribati currently reports 108.04 against 107.27 in Nicaragua, a difference of 0.77.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1962 it was Kiribati ahead.

Kiribati ranks 7th and Nicaragua ranks 10th of 180 countries.

Kiribati has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

CTOT is a comprehensive database of country-specific commodity price indices for 182 economies covering the period from 1962 onwards. For each country, the change in the international price of up to 45 individual commodities is weighted using commodity-level trade data. The database includes a commodity terms-of-trade index—which proxies the windfall gains and losses of income associated with changes in world prices—as well as additional country-specific series, including commodity export and import price indices. It includes indices that are constructed using, alternatively, fixed weights (based on average trade flows over several decades) and time-varying weights (which can account for time variation in the mix of commodities traded and the overall importance of commodities in economic activity)
